FROM the producers of the Banff Film Festival tour comes a collection of canine-inspired short films about dogs and their people. Following its sell-out success internationally, the Top Dog Film Festival is coming to the UK for the first time featuring dogs from all walks of life on the big screen.

A tour spokesman said: “Meet four-legged heroes, unbreakable bonds and canine companions that enrich the lives of all those they encounter.

“This carefully curated programme of canine-themed films is comprised of the most inspirational and entertaining stories about dogs and their human companions, from independent films makers around the globe.”

There will be a screening at Lighthouse Poole on Thursday, October 3 at 7.30pm. For more details, see topdogfilmfestival.co.uk

The UK tour will be visiting several Dorset theatres with a new collection of ocean-themed films. “From surfers to fisherman, and marine scientists to artists, these films feature fascinating characters who have dedicated their lives to the sea’s salt spray,” says tour director Nell Teasdale.

“This is your chance to dip your toes into the wonders of the big blue from the comfort of a cinema seat.”

The tour will visit Tivoli Theatre on September 18 followed by the Regent Centre on October 2 and 17, and Lighthouse, Poole on October 18. For more details, visit oceanfilmfestival.co.uk
